On Adaptive Bandwidth Sharing with Rate Guarantees
نویسندگان
چکیده
The objective of recent research in fair queueing schemes has been to efficiently emulate a fluid-flow generalized (weighted) processor sharing (GPS) system, as closely as possible. A primary motivation for the use of fair-queueing has been its use as a means of providing bandwidth guarantees and as a consequence end-to-end delay bounds for traffic with bounded burstiness. The rate guarantees translate to scheduling weights which are set when admission control is done. A consequence of fair queueing systems closely emulating GPS is that when one or more connections are not backlogged, any “excess” bandwidth is distributed to backlogged connections in proportion to their weights. However, weights are set based on the longterm requirements of traffic flows and not in any state-dependent manner that reflects instantaneous needs. In this paper, we question the notion that queueing systems should closely emulate a GPS system. Instead of emulating GPS, we propose three modified scheduling schemes which preserve the rate guarantees of fair queueing (and hence preserve deterministic delay bounds) but adaptively redistribute the excess bandwidth such that either losses are reduced or delays equalized. We compare the performance of the proposed schemes to that of fair queueing using different traffic sources such as voice and video, as well as sources which have aggregate long-range dependent behavior. We find that the proposed schemes, in comparison to packet GPS (PGPS), reduce packet losses and curtail the tails of delay distributions for real-time traffic and hence permit the use of significantly smaller playout buffers for the same network load.
منابع مشابه
Performance of Multi-beam Satellite Systems With A New Bandwidth Sharing Algorithm
An efficient resource allocation is important to guarantee the best performance with a fair distribution of multi-beam satellite capacity to provide satellite multimedia and broadcasting services. In this way, available bandwidth and capacity problems in new satellite system likes Multi-Input-Multi-Output (MIMO), exploring new techniques for enhancing spectral efficiency in satellite communicat...
متن کاملAdapting Fair Queueing to Improve Loss, Delay, and Admission Control Performance
Fair queueing provides minimum rate guarantees and is fair by being rate proportional, i.e, excess bandwidth due to non-backlogged connections is distributed in proportion to rate guarantees. State dependence of the scheduler is restricted to whether specific connections are backlogged or not. In this paper, we propose three alternate scheduling mechanisms that can provide better service, in te...
متن کاملDesign and Evaluation of a Method for Partitioning and Offloading Web-based Applications in Mobile Systems with Bandwidth Constraints
Computation offloading is known to be among the effective solutions of running heavy applications on smart mobile devices. However, irregular changes of a mobile data rate have direct impacts on code partitioning when offloading is in progress. It is believed that once a rate-adaptive partitioning performed, the replication of such substantial processes due to bandwidth fluctuation can be avoid...
متن کاملPredictive routing to enhance QoS for stream-based flows sharing excess bandwidth
We propose a new routing algorithm based on online estimation of the link load dynamics and prior information on flow holding times. The motivation for this proposal lies in supporting traffic flows such as VBR or associated with rate adaptive applications. Such traffic requires a minimal guaranteed bandwidth, but can see improved performance when sharing excess bandwidth not used to meet guara...
متن کاملSupporting Adaptive Flows in a Quality of Service Architecture
Distributed audio and video applications need to adapt to fluctuations in delivered quality of service (QoS). By trading off temporal and spatial quality to available bandwidth, or manipulating the playout time of continuous media in response to variation in delay, audio and video flows can be made to adapt to fluctuating QoS with minimal perceptual distortion. In this paper we extend our previ...
متن کامل